"""blog interfaces to data for bitsy""" import os import utils from cStringIO import StringIO from glob import glob class BlogEntry(object): """interface class for a blog entry""" def __init__(self, date, body, privacy, user): self.date = date self.body = body self.privacy = privacy if user is not None: self.user = user def title(self, characters=80): if '\n' in self.body: lines = [i.strip() for i in self.body[:characters].split('\n')] if len(lines[0]) > characters: return self.snippet(charachters) if len(lines) > 1 and not lines[1]: return lines[0] return self.snippet(characters) def snippet(self, characters=80): if characters: if len(self.body) > characters: text = ' '.join(self.body[:characters].split()[:-1]) if '\n' in text: lines = [ i.strip() for i in text.split('\n') ] if '' in lines: return '\n'.join(lines[:lines.index('')]) if text: return '%s ...' % text else: return self.body return '' def datestamp(self): return utils.datestamp(self.date) class Blog(object): """abstract class for a users' blog""" def __call__(self, user, permissions=('public',), number=None): return self.blog(user, permissions, number=number) def latest(self, users, number): """return the lastest entries""" blog = [] for user in users: blog.extend(self.blog(user, ('public',), number)) blog.sort(key=lambda entry: entry.date, reverse=True) return blog[:number] # interfaces for subclasses def blog(self, user, permissions, number=None): """ return the user's blog sorted in reverse date order if number is None, the entire blog is returned """ def entry(self, user, datestamp, permissions): """ return a single blog entry with the given datestamp: 'YYYYMMDDHHMMSS' """ def entries(self, user, permissions, year=None, month=None, day=None): """return entries by date""" def post(self, user, date, text, privacy): """post a new blog entry""" def delete(self, user, datestamp): """remove a blog entry""" class FileBlog(Blog): """a blog that lives on the filesystem""" def __init__(self, directory): self.directory = directory def location(self, user, permission, *path): """returns which directory files are in based on permission""" return os.path.join(self.directory, user, 'entries', permission, *path) def body(self, user, datestamp, permission): return file(self.location(user, permission, datestamp)).read() def get_entry(self, user, datestamp, permission): return BlogEntry(utils.date(datestamp), self.body(user, datestamp, permission), permission, user) ### interfaces from Blog def blog(self, user, permissions, number=None): entries = [] for permission in permissions: entries.extend([ (entry, permission) for entry in os.listdir(self.location(user, permission)) ]) entries.sort(key=lambda x: x[0], reverse=True) if number is not None: entries = entries[:number] return [ self.get_entry(user, x[0], x[1]) for x in entries ] def entry(self, user, datestamp, permissions): for permission in permissions: filename = self.location(user, permission, datestamp) if os.path.exists(filename): return self.get_entry(user, datestamp, permission) def entries(self, user, permissions, year=None, month=None, day=None): # build a file glob expression dateargs = [ year, month, day, None ] glob_expr = '' for index in range(len(dateargs)): value = dateargs[index] if value is None: break length = len(utils.timeformat[index]) glob_expr += '%0*d' % (length, int(value)) while index < len(utils.timeformat): glob_expr += '[0-9]' * len(utils.timeformat[index]) index += 1 # get the blog entries entries = [] for permission in permissions: entries.extend([ (os.path.split(entry)[-1], permission) for entry in glob(os.path.join(self.location(user, permission), glob_expr)) ]) entries.sort(key=lambda x: x[0], reverse=True) return [ self.get_entry(user, x[0], x[1]) for x in entries ] def post(self, user, datestamp, body, privacy): blog = file(self.location(user, privacy, datestamp), 'w') print >> blog, body def delete(self, user, datestamp): for permission in 'public', 'secret', 'private': path = self.location(user, permission, datestamp) if os.path.exists(path): os.remove(path)
